Serine protease inhibitor Kazal-type 1 (SPINK1) is a small, secreted protein produced primarily by pancreatic acinar cells, acting as an essential inhibitor of trypsin. Its physiological role is to prevent autodigestion of the pancreas by blocking prematurely activated trypsin within zymogen granules and ducts. Loss-of-function mutations in SPINK1 predispose individuals to several forms of pancreatitis, with the most widely studied N34S mutation linked to increased disease risk. Beyond the pancreas, SPINK1 is also known as tumor-associated trypsin inhibitor (TATI) and plays a role in cancer biology by promoting cell survival, proliferation, and metastasis, especially via epidermal growth factor receptor (EGFR) signaling. SPINK1 is overexpressed in several cancers and serves as a biomarker for poor prognosis and aggressive disease subtypes. Although no direct therapeutic agents currently target SPINK1, it interacts with signaling pathways modulated by established drugs, such as EGFR inhibitors in oncology.
Competitive inhibition of trypsin, binding to and blocking the active site, rendering the enzyme inactive. Activation of EGFR signaling pathways in cancer models, driving proliferation and survival. Inhibition of granzyme A activity in tumor cells, preventing apoptosis. Potential involvement in cellular plasticity and resistance to chemotherapy via indirect pathways.
